This is a high-quality card edge connector designed for versatile applications, featuring a contact spacing of 0.156 inches (3.96 mm) and accommodating up to 86 contacts. It has P.C. tail sizes of 0.046 x 0.013 inches (1.17 x 0.33 mm) and a tail length of 0.213 inches (5.41 mm). The insulator is made of UL 94V-0 thermoplastic polyester, ensuring durability and safety. Mounting options include two 0.128-inch (3.25 mm) diameter holes for secure attachment, suitable for various electronic assemblies and circuit board configurations.
Insulator Material: Thermoplastic Polyester, UL 94V-0
Contact Material: Copper, Nickel, Tin Alloy CA-725
Contact Plating: Gold on mating area, Tin on contact tails, Nickel underplate
Current Rating: 5 Amperes continuous
Contact Resistance: 10 milliohms maximum
Dielectric Withstanding Voltage: 1800 V AC rms at sea level
Insulation Resistance: Minimum 5000 Megohms
Operating Temperature: -65°C to +105°C
Mounting Holes: Two 0.128-inch (3.25 mm) diameter holes
Application: Suitable for electronic circuit boards and module connections
